Unnamed
Laura Bay, SE of Ceduna
Unnamed was a cutter built in and lost on 1964. Sailing the fishing cutter at night into Laura Bay when it grounded on a reef at low tide on the west side of the bay. The vessel was holed and unable to be saved, soon breaking up from the pounding waves.
